First Violation Penalties
When facing your very first DWI cost, what fines should you anticipate? You might face a variety of repercussions, beginning with fines that can rise to $2,000.
In addition to punitive damages, you can likewise handle a permit suspension, typically lasting from 90 days to a year, depending upon your state's laws.
Social work is an additional likely demand; you may need to complete anywhere from 20 to 40 hours.
If you're convicted, you could likewise have to go to a DWI education and learning program, which can include a considerable time dedication.
In many cases, you might also be called for to install an ignition interlock device in your automobile, which avoids you from driving if you've been consuming alcohol.
Jail time is an opportunity, but it's usually less than a year for a first crime, especially if there are no aggravating variables like a crash or high blood alcohol material.

Repeat Crime Charges
Dealing with a repeat DWI charge can bring about significantly harsher fines than a first infraction. If you're captured driving while intoxicated once more, you might deal with enhanced penalties, longer permit suspensions, or perhaps required jail time. The legal system tends to see repeat culprits as a better threat to public security, so your effects will certainly mirror that.
For your 2nd dui, fines commonly double. You could be considering fines varying from $1,000 to $5,000, relying on your state. Additionally, you may face a minimal license suspension of one year or more.
If this is your third infraction or higher, the penalties intensify even better. You may be punished to numerous months in jail, and some territories may also require you to install an ignition interlock tool in your car.
Additionally, several states implement mandatory alcohol education and learning or treatment programs for repeat culprits, including in the total burden.

Long-lasting Consequences
Long-term repercussions of a drunk driving cost can influence different aspects of your life for several years to find.
Once you've been founded guilty, you may deal with greater insurance costs or perhaps difficulty obtaining cars and truck insurance coverage in any way. Insurance companies usually see you as a higher danger, which can cause considerable financial pressure.
Your employment opportunities may also decrease. Numerous employers carry out background checks, and a DWI conviction can elevate red flags, potentially costing you task deals or promotions. Specific careers, particularly those calling for a tidy driving document, may be totally out-of-bounds.
